Programmable universal temperature controller insert with touch display: The programmable universal temperature controller insert with touch display can be used to regulate the room or floor temperature. It is operated via a touch display. Electric underfloor heating, radiators or actuators can be connected to the controller. The thermostat has a weekly clock with individually adjustable programs. Alternatively, you can choose between 3 pre-programmed programs. Various heating modes are available: Comfort mode, ECO mode and frost protection mode. The thermostat can be operated in four different operating modes: Room air mode. The internal temperature sensor records the room temperature and regulates it. Floor mode. The floor sensor available as an accessory records the floor temperature and regulates the electric underfloor heating. Dual mode. The internal temperature sensor records the room temperature and regulates it. At the same time, the floor sensor monitors the floor temperature and limits it to the preset maximum temperature. This operating mode is particularly recommended for temperature-sensitive parquet or laminate floors. PWM operation. The positive width modulation (PWM) switches the heating on and off at regular intervals. The desired temperature is set using the PWM value. The floor sensor is not functional in this operating mode. The room temperature limits are adhered to. Functions: -Automatic summer/winter time changeover. -Valve protection function. -Operating hours display. -Controller behavior: PWM or 2-point. -Relay output behavior: normally closed/normally closed. -Self-learning lead times. Rated voltage: AC 230 V, 50 Hz. Rated load (ohmic): 3680 W, 16 A. Rated load (inductive): 1 A, cos phi = 0.6. Operating temperature: -10 degrees C to +35 degrees C. Setting range. Room temperature: + 5 degrees C to +35 degrees C. Floor temperature: + 5 degrees C to +50 degrees C.
